A car and its passengers have a mass of 1200kg it is travelling at 12m/s.

Answer:

<em>The increase of kinetic energy is 108,000 J</em>

Explanation:

<u>Kinetic Energy </u>

Is the energy an object has due to its state of motion. It's proportional to the square of the speed and the mass.

The equation for the kinetic energy is:

\displaystyle K=\frac{1}{2}mv^2

Where:

m = mass of the object

v = speed at which the object moves

The kinetic energy is expressed in Joules (J)

A car has a total mass of m=1,200 kg and travels at v1=12 m/s. Then it increases its speed at v2=18 m/s.

It's required to compute the increase of kinetic energy. We'll calculate both energies K1 and K2 and then subtract them.

\displaystyle K_1=\frac{1}{2}1,200*12^2=86,400\ J

\displaystyle K_2=\frac{1}{2}1,200*18^2=194,400\ J

The increase of kinetic energy is:

\Delta K=K_2-K_1 =194,400\ J-86,400\ J

\Delta K=108,000\ J

The increase of kinetic energy is 108,000 J

A ball of mass 0.075 kg is fired horizontally into a ballistic pendulum. The pendulum mass is 0.350 kg. The ball is caught in th
Tatiana [17]
1) In the initial situation, the total mechanical energy of the system is given only by the kinetic energy of the ball that is moving with speed v:
E_i =K= \frac{1}{2}m_b v^2
where m_b = 0.075 kg is the mass of the ball.

In the final situation, where the system (ball+pendulum) rises a vertical distance of h=0.145 m, the system is stationary (v=0) so the total mechanical energy of the system is the gravitational potential energy:
E_f = U = (m_b+m_p)gh
where m_p = 0.350 kg is the mass of the pendulum.

For the law of conservation of energy, E_i=E_f , so we can find the initial speed v of the ball:
\frac{1}{2}m_bv^2 = (m_b+m_p)gh
v= \sqrt{ 2 \frac{m_b+m_p}{m_b}gh } =4.0 m/s

2) The kinetic energy lost in the collision is the initial kinetic energy of the ball:
K= \frac{1}{2}m_bv^2= \frac{1}{2}(0.075 kg)(4.0 m/s)^2=0.6 J

A double stranded dna molecule contains 300 adenine molecules and 240 cytosine molecules. How many guanine molecules are in this
Maurinko [17]

Answer:

240 molecules

Explanation:

According to the chargaff rules, the amount of adenine  is equal to the amount of thymine  and the amount of guanine  is equal to the amount of cytosine. Therefore:

G=C\\A=T

Now, its easy to conclude:

G=C=240\hspace{3}molecules

As an object is undergoing free fall motion.As it falls the objects?,speed increases,acceleration increases,both of these,or non
Alex_Xolod [135]
The speed will increase, as there is acceleration, while the acceleration will remain constant, as gravity is constant.

2. Montesquieu's view of the separation of powers was later expressed in the United States Government through which document? A.
tensa zangetsu [6.8K]

Answer: b. The United States Constitution

Explanation:

Montesquieu argued that the best form of government, was one where the legislative arm, executive arm, and judicial powers were separate. and in doing so helped kept each other in check to prevent any branch from becoming too powerful. Montesquieu’s separation of powers was not accurate when compared the government of England, But this was later adopted by Americans as the foundation of the U.S. Constitution.
